A Russian drone strike damaged part of the Centralized Spent Nuclear Fuel Storage Facilityin the Chornobyl Exclusion Zone overnight on June 7,
Ukraine's state nuclear operator Energoatom reported.
The attack comes amid growing concerns about nuclear safety in Ukraine,
as Russia continues to strike infrastructure tied to the country's energy system and nuclear sector

Just did very approximate calculations; with 10g of lithium per drone*, and assuming the Russian and Ukrainian drone efforts consume 5m units a year**, that'd be ~50 tons of lithium deposited into the environment per year, mostly within, let's say, 50km of the grey zone***. It's only about $20,000 / ton****, which means $1m of metal*****.
So to answer my own silly question: no, it won't be economically viable to scalp the top few inches of topsoil and extract the lithium from it.
* Roughly right for quadcopters / small FPV; larger and longer range ones will have more, so this is a bottom bound. (OTOH longer range UAVs will tend to use ICE kerosene rather than batteries
** Changing all the time as both sides try expanding production as fast as they can manage. Ua are scaling much faster at time of writing
*** Handwaving. Contact zone's hardly moved since early 2023; OTOH Ua are pushing range limits on small battery-powered form factor, saw a 60km claim for the Logistics Lockdown operation the other day
**** There was a big spike to the $70-8000 range in 2022; median price is closer to $10k than $20k
***** (IDK the chemistry but presumably it's in an exciting range of different compounds, depending on how many bits the battery was blown into, how hot / pressured the blast wave was a few tens of mm from the boom, what other stuff was in the vicinity that the lithium would combine with, etc etc.
